INOvent delivery system FOR NITRIC OXIDE THERAPY INOvent Application Update 11 INOvent delivery system Please place with INOvent Operation and Maintenance Manual STERILIZING AND DISINFECTION METHODS FOR INOvent DELIVERY SYSTEM INJECTOR MODULE New method approved Recently SPOROX II Disinfecting and Sterilization solution manufactured by Sultan Chemists Inc has been tested for use as a disinfectant and or sterilant for use with the Datex Ohmeda INOvent injector module SPOROX II is a high grade hydrogen peroxide solution When properly used high level disinfection will be achieved in 30 minutes and sterilization in 6 hours SPOROX II is virucidal sporicidal tuberculocidal fungicidal and bactericidal All of the cautions associated with cleaning an injector module identified in the O amp M manual still apply when using SPOROX II D Datex Ohmeda Detailed information can be found on the Sultan Chemists web site www sultanchemists com including directions for use material safety data sheet MSDS and worldwide distribution network The other approved methods of sterilizing and disinfection for the INOvent injector module are included on back for your reference Sporox is a trademark of Sultan Chemists Inc INOvent delivery system CAUTION Don t sterilize or disinfect with the power High level disinfecting connected 1 Fill a container with ethyl alcohol 70 by Do not t
